How they compare
Marshall Islands currently reports 0.5 against 0.46 in Uruguay, a difference of 0.04.
That makes Marshall Islands's figure about 1.1 times Uruguay's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Uruguay ahead.
Marshall Islands ranks 96th and Uruguay ranks 99th of 192 countries.
Marshall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Marshall Islands | Uruguay |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.771 | 0.458 | 0.313 | Marshall Islands |
| 2010s | 0.648 | 0.512 | 0.136 | Marshall Islands |
| 2020s | 0.515 | 0.47 | 0.045 | Marshall Islands |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
